+Microchip SparX-5 SoC
+=====================
+
+Supported chips:
+
+ * VSC7546, VSC7549, VSC755, VSC7556, and VSC7558 (Sparx5 series)
+
+ Prefix: 'sparx5-temp'
+
+ Addresses scanned: -
+
+ Datasheet: Provided by Microchip upon request and under NDA
+
+Author: Lars Povlsen <lars.povlsen@microchip.com>
+
+Description
+-----------
+
+The Sparx5 SoC contains a temperature sensor based on the MR74060
+Moortec IP.
+
+The sensor has a range of -40°C to +125°C and an accuracy of +/-5°C.
+
+Sysfs entries
+-------------
+
+The following attributes are supported.
+
+======================= ========================================================
+temp1_input Die temperature (in millidegree Celsius.)
+======================= ========================================================
